CPR training teaches teachers to perform
cardiopulmonary resuscitation—chest compressions and rescue breaths—to help
someone whose heart has stopped, combining hands-on practice with learning
to use an AED (Automated External Defibrillator) to double or triple
survival chances during cardiac emergencies.

Learning outcomes focus on equipping teachers
to recognize emergencies, activate the emergency system (call 911), and
provide immediate, high-quality care (CPR, AED use, choking relief, bleeding
control) until professionals arrive, ultimately preserving life by improving
survival rates for cardiac and breathing emergencies, while also boosting
confidence and community safety.
